Camping
Camping is a great way to experience the bush and see wildlife. Queensland's parks and forests offer a range of camping opportunities, from remote camp sites for bushwalkers to camping areas with amenities and sites for camper trailers and caravans as well as tents.

Things to do
Nature-based recreation and tourism are allowed in most Queensland national parks where you can walk, camp, watch birds, ride horses or mountain bikes, or venture out in your four-wheel-drive. Permits are required for some activities in some locations.
